Breast Repair and/or Reconstruction: Changes for 2021 (April 2021)
April 2021 pages 3-6 Breast Repair and/or Reconstruction: Changes for 2021 For the Current Procedural Terminology (CPT®) 2021 code set, a significant number of codes were revised or deleted in the Breast subsection of the Integumentary System section. In addition, new introductory guidelines were added to the Repair and/or Reconstruction subsection, along with numerous instructional parenthetical notes. All of these changes were made to reflect current practice, simplify terms, and clarify physician work. This article provides an overview of these changes.
